Expertise and Training
The first and foremost aspect to consider is the expertise and training of the doctor. A qualified professional should have extensive training in cosmetic tattooing, preferably from accredited institutions. Look for certifications in permanent makeup or micropigmentation from recognized bodies. Additionally, experience in the field is equally important. A doctor with several years of practice and a portfolio of successful procedures can offer you the confidence that they are adept at handling various skin types and colors.
Licensing and Regulation
Regulatory compliance is another critical factor. Ensure that the doctor you choose is licensed to perform permanent makeup procedures in Point Fortin. This information can typically be found on their website or by contacting the local health department. Licensing ensures that the practitioner adheres to safety standards and uses hygienic practices, reducing the risk of infections and other complications.
Technique and Equipment
The technique and equipment used by the doctor can significantly impact the outcome of your permanent makeup. Modern techniques such as microblading, shading, and machine methods offer different levels of precision and longevity. Discuss with your doctor the techniques they use and why they prefer them. Additionally, inquire about the equipment, including needles, pigments, and sterilization methods. High-quality, disposable equipment is essential to prevent cross-contamination and ensure a safe procedure.

Consultation Process
A thorough consultation process is essential before undergoing permanent makeup. During the consultation, the doctor should assess your skin type, color, and the desired outcome. This is also an opportunity to discuss any allergies, medical conditions, or medications that might affect the procedure. A good doctor will provide a realistic expectation of the results and discuss potential risks and aftercare instructions. This personalized approach ensures that the procedure is tailored to your specific needs.

FAQ
Q: How long does permanent makeup last?
A: Permanent makeup typically lasts between 1 to 3 years, depending on the technique used, skin type, and aftercare practices.
Q: Is permanent makeup painful?
A: Most doctors use topical anesthetics to minimize discomfort during the procedure. While some clients may experience mild discomfort, the process is generally well-tolerated.
Q: Can I choose any color for my permanent makeup?
A: Yes, you can choose the color during the consultation. However, the doctor will advise on the most suitable colors based on your skin tone and natural features.
Q: What are the risks of permanent makeup?
A: Potential risks include infection, allergic reactions, and uneven results. Choosing a licensed and experienced doctor significantly reduces these risks.
Q: How do I care for my permanent makeup after the procedure?
A: Follow the aftercare instructions provided by your doctor, which typically include keeping the area clean, avoiding sun exposure, and not picking at scabs. Proper aftercare is crucial for optimal healing and longevity of the makeup.
